J.K. Rowling Joanne Kathleen Rowling was born in England in 1965. It was always her dream to be a writer. She was an English teacher in Portugal. Now she lives in Scotland and she likes writing in cafés and she doesn't write on a computer. She is one of the most famous writers in the world. Harry Potter Series created by

Hogwart's Magic School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ry
Hogwarts is a Boarding school of magic for witches and wizards between the ages of eleven and seventeen living in the United Kingdom and Ireland.
